Ovarian Cancer : In 1995, the rate of women being
diagnosed with ovarian cancer each year in the United States was 22,000 (Anonymous 1995).
This form of cancer is not easily detected in the early stages, which means that by the
time it is diagnosed, serious health problems have occurred. Ovarian cancer is less
prevalent than breast cancer, has a higher mortality rate and is linked with the same
genetically presupposed gene. It is the fourth leading cause of cancer mortality in the
United States causing 14 500 deaths in 1998 (Bonn, 1999). An annual pelvic exam and
possible the new testing for the gene are the most common preventative measures. This 5
page paper explores the physiological repercussions of this deadly disease. Bibliography
lists 6 sources. KTovarian.wps
Hydatiform Mole : A 5 page overview of the
reproductive disease that is a component of Gestational trophoblastic disease (GTD) and is
almost always a precursor of choriocarcinoma. It is an abnormal placenta that develops
into a tumor, and results either in miscarriage or death of the fetus. The tumor can be
malignant, but it almost always is benign. It is a subject rarely discussed with the
patient or in patient literature, yet its incidence makes it more common than some other
forms of abnormalities that are well known, such as Downs Syndrome. Bibliography
lists 9 sources. H-Mole.wps
